Bari's San Paolo Oncology Unit Gets Queue‑Management System Donation

On 18 May at 09:30, an intelligent “elimina‑code” totem was delivered to the oncology department of San Paolo Hospital in Bari, Italy.

The system was donated by the Rotary Club Bari Alto “Terra dei Peuceti” together with the non‑profit Energia Donna. It is designed to streamline patient waiting times, improve service efficiency and provide greater comfort for patients and families during cancer treatment, as part of a local initiative to support health‑care services.
